v1.0.0 - 10/02/2017

Initial release of XBee Python library. The main features of the library include:

  • Support for ZigBee, 802.15.4, DigiMesh, Point-to-Multipoint, Wi-Fi, Cellular and NB-IoT devices.

  • Support for API and API escaped operating modes.

  • Management of local (attached to the PC) and remote XBee device objects.

  • Discovery of remote XBee devices associated with the same network as the local device.

  • Configuration of local and remote XBee devices:

    • Configure common parameters with specific setters and getters.

    • Configure any other parameter with generic methods.

    • Execute AT commands.

    • Apply configuration changes.

    • Write configuration changes.

    • Reset the device.

  • Transmission of data to all the XBee devices on the network or to a specific device.

  • Reception of data from remote XBee devices:

    • Data polling.

    • Data reception callback.

  • Transmission and reception of IP and SMS messages.

  • Reception of network status changes related to the local XBee device.

  • IO lines management:

    • Configure IO lines.

    • Set IO line value.

    • Read IO line value.

    • Receive IO data samples from any remote XBee device on the network.

  • Support for explicit frames and application layer fields (Source endpoint, Destination endpoint, Profile ID, and Cluster ID).

  • Multiple examples that show how to use the available APIs.
